+static int
+vsl_nextlog(struct VSM_data *vd, uint32_t **pp)
+{
+ unsigned w, l;
+ uint32_t t;
+ int i;
+
+ CHECK_OBJ_NOTNULL(vd, VSM_MAGIC);
+ if (vd->r_fd != -1) {
+ assert(vd->rbuflen >= 8);
+ i = read(vd->r_fd, vd->rbuf, 8);
+ if (i != 8)
+ return (-1);
+ l = 2 + VSL_WORDS(VSL_LEN(vd->rbuf));
+ if (vd->rbuflen < l) {
+ l += 256;
+ vd->rbuf = realloc(vd->rbuf, l * 4);
+ assert(vd->rbuf != NULL);
+ vd->rbuflen = l;
+ }
+ i = read(vd->r_fd, vd->rbuf + 2, l * 4 - 8);
+ if (i != l)
+ return (-1);
+ *pp = vd->rbuf;
+ return (1);
+ }
+ for (w = 0; w < TIMEOUT_USEC;) {
+ t = *vd->log_ptr;
+
+ if (t == VSL_WRAPMARKER ||
+ (t == VSL_ENDMARKER && vd->last_seq != vd->log_start[0])) {
+ vd->log_ptr = vd->log_start + 1;
+ vd->last_seq = vd->log_start[0];
+ VRMB();
+ continue;
+ }
+ if (t == VSL_ENDMARKER) {
+ if (vd->flags & F_NON_BLOCKING)
+ return (-1);
+ w += SLEEP_USEC;
+ AZ(usleep(SLEEP_USEC));
+ continue;
+ }
+ *pp = (void*)(uintptr_t)vd->log_ptr; /* Loose volatile */
+ vd->log_ptr = VSL_NEXT(vd->log_ptr);
+ return (1);
+ }
+ *pp = NULL;
+ return (0);
+}

+int
+VSL_NextLog(struct VSM_data *vd, uint32_t **pp)
+{
+ uint32_t *p;
+ unsigned char t;
+ unsigned u;
+ int i;
+
+ CHECK_OBJ_NOTNULL(vd, VSM_MAGIC);
+ while (1) {
+ i = vsl_nextlog(vd, &p);
+ if (i != 1)
+ return (i);
+ u = VSL_ID(p);
+ t = VSL_TAG(p);
+ switch(t) {
+ case SLT_SessionOpen:
+ case SLT_ReqStart:
+ vbit_set(vd->vbm_client, u);
+ vbit_clr(vd->vbm_backend, u);
+ break;
+ case SLT_BackendOpen:
+ case SLT_BackendXID:
+ vbit_clr(vd->vbm_client, u);
+ vbit_set(vd->vbm_backend, u);
+ break;
+ default:
+ break;
+ }
+ if (vd->skip) {
+ --vd->skip;
+ continue;
+ } else if (vd->keep) {
+ if (--vd->keep == 0)
+ return (-1);
+ }
+
+ if (vbit_test(vd->vbm_select, t)) {
+ *pp = p;
+ return (1);
+ }
+ if (vbit_test(vd->vbm_supress, t))
+ continue;
+ if (vd->b_opt && !vbit_test(vd->vbm_backend, u))
+ continue;
+ if (vd->c_opt && !vbit_test(vd->vbm_client, u))
+ continue;
+ if (vd->regincl != NULL) {
+ i = VRE_exec(vd->regincl, VSL_DATA(p), VSL_LEN(p),
+ 0, 0, NULL, 0);
+ if (i == VRE_ERROR_NOMATCH)
+ continue;
+ }
+ if (vd->regexcl != NULL) {
+ i = VRE_exec(vd->regincl, VSL_DATA(p), VSL_LEN(p),
+ 0, 0, NULL, 0);
+ if (i != VRE_ERROR_NOMATCH)
+ continue;
+ }
+ *pp = p;
+ return (1);
+ }
+}
